Jupyter notebook运行后打不开网页的问题解决
作者:陈承宇-?。- 时间:2021-07-10 01:35:30
前言:
最近正在上一门Python数据处理的课程,要用到Jupyter,于是就先安装了anaconda,当我正准备运行Jupyter时点了一下launch,没反应......于是又点了一遍,还是没反应......很迷,正常来说应该会跳出来一个网页来说才对,于是开始上网查,最后解决了这个问题。现在把具体的实现流程写出来。
正文:
首先在命令行窗口输入命令:jupyter notebook --generate-config:
鉴于大家碰到“找不到该命令”这个问题的比较多,我就在这里多做一点配置环境变量的补充,碰到这个问题的朋友们可以留意一下。
首先,右键”我的电脑“点开”属性”,右边有个“高级系统设置”点开它,然后会弹出一个框,在那个框里点击环境变量,就进入到下面这个界面:
然后在用户变量中的Path和系统变量中的Path分别都添加上以下三个路径:
如此便可以解决”找不到jupyter该命令“的问题了。
然后它会创建一个一个名为:jupyter_notebook_config.py 的文件,在终端里面有具体的路径,只需要复制到我的电脑里面查找就行:
找到这个文件,然后用记事本打开:
找到:#c.NotebookApp.browser = '' 这个地方,然后添加以下代码:
import webbrowser
webbrowser.register('chrome',None,webbrowser.GenericBrowser
(u'C:\Program Files\Google\Chrome\Application\chrome.exe'))
c.NotebookApp.browser = 'chrome'
具体是长这样的:
其中u‘ 后面带的是你浏览器的路径,像我用的是谷歌浏览器,填的就是谷歌浏览器的路径。然后重新打开anaconda再launch就可以看到打开网页了。
怎么查看浏览器的具体路径呢:
右键点击这个浏览器的图标,然后点击“打开文件所在的位置”就可以找到啦:
点击launch后就会出现这样的一个页面了:
如果还是解决不了这个问题的话,可以找找是否还有其他问题存在,如果是网页打不开的情况的话,大概率都是没有指定一个打开的浏览器,在config里面配置完一般就可以打开了。
PS:如果成功打开网页之后,运行代码后没有反应,in[ ]里面什么都没有,跳到了下一行。且右上角的圆圈呈实心的,显示内核正忙,可以参考我的第二篇文章:
jupyter notebook运行代码没反应且in[ ]没有*
来源:https://blog.csdn.net/weixin_51043896/article/details/120140666
![](/images/zang.png)
![](/images/jiucuo.png)
猜你喜欢
python引入导入自定义模块和外部文件的实例
轻松了解数据库计算机的概念和发展方向
SQLSERVER 本地查询更新操作远程数据库的代码
Laravel中使用阿里云OSS Composer包分享
python3实现弹弹球小游戏
![](https://img.aspxhome.com/file/2023/1/75881_0s.jpg)
Mootools 1.2教程(14)——定时器和哈希简介
pytorch __init__、forward与__call__的用法小结
![](https://img.aspxhome.com/file/2023/4/117284_0s.jpg)
MySQL 视图,第1349号错误
详解python中文编码问题
![](https://img.aspxhome.com/file/2023/2/63512_0s.png)
Python图像运算之腐蚀与膨胀详解
![](https://img.aspxhome.com/file/2023/2/114792_0s.png)
python匿名函数的使用方法解析
Python异常处理知识点总结
Python队列RabbitMQ 使用方法实例记录
![](https://img.aspxhome.com/file/2023/3/83753_0s.png)
python实现智能语音天气预报
![](https://img.aspxhome.com/file/2023/2/78532_0s.jpg)
PHP封装cURL工具类与应用示例
八卦调侃Reset CSS
JS onmousemove鼠标移动坐标接龙DIV效果实例
![](https://img.aspxhome.com/file/2023/0/56030_0s.gif)
简单介绍Python中的try和finally和with方法
Pandas对每个分组应用apply函数的实现
![](https://img.aspxhome.com/file/2023/5/78775_0s.jpg)
详解tf.device()指定tensorflow运行的GPU或CPU设备实现
![](https://img.aspxhome.com/file/2023/7/110407_0s.jpg)